Bernard Pictet: Crafting Brilliance in Glass

In the realm of glass artistry, the workshop of Bernard Pictet stands as a testament to innovation and creativity. Founded in 1981, this unique glassmaking atelier has evolved over the years, producing astonishing creations that redefine the very essence of glass.

Pictet’s journey is one of continuous exploration and refinement. Initially dedicating a decade to perfecting classical models, he then boldly ventured into a more personal and avant-garde realm. The workshop became a hub for technical experimentation, embracing methods such as engraving, sandblasting, chiseling, and gilding. It is within this creative crucible that Pictet developed a matériauthèque boasting over three hundred motifs, drawing inspiration from contemporary art giants like Pierre Soulages and Anish Kapoor, as well as the intricate beauty of the botanical world.

As the torch has been passed to Aurélie Kostka, the legacy of Bernard Pictet lives on. The workshop proudly positions itself as a Haute-Couture glassmaker, armed with four decades of experience and research in cold glass decoration. Their expertise enables them to not only undertake creative challenges but also navigate the intricate balance between innovation and adherence to safety standards.

The year 2023 marked a series of triumphs for Bernard Pictet’s workshop. From a yacht refit and collaborations with renowned design entities like Reymond Langton Design and Zuretti Design to creating opulent spaces such as a high-luxury apartment in London with Peter Marino Architect and Testimonio in Monaco with Laura Sessa—the portfolio is a testament to the workshop’s versatility and commitment to excellence.

Monumental doors for Dior Couture boutiques in Shanghai and Geneva, a basin reflecting a centennial chandelier for La Mamounia, and contributions to the New Orient Express bar set to be inaugurated in 2024—all these projects underscore the workshop’s involvement in prestigious ventures.
